Developed initially by Sonic Foundry and later distributed by Sony Creative Software, the Noise Reduction 2.0 plug-in was a DirectX (DX) effect. This allowed it to work not only with Sony applications like and Vegas Pro but also with other DAWs that supported DX plugins. sony noise reduction plugin 2.0 serial number

It worked best as a 32-bit plug-in. However, this compatibility became a nightmare with the shift to 64-bit systems. For instance, users trying to install version 2.0b in Vegas Pro 11 (32-bit) would find that their serial number for the older 2.0b version would not be accepted by the newer 2.0h version.

Many users never realized they owned a license for the plugin in the first place. The Sony Noise Reduction license was commonly bundled with earlier versions of Sony's flagship products. Specifically, Sound Forge Pro version came with it as a bonus, and by version 8 it was fully bundled. Sound Forge Pro 9 also came with it.
